So Isinbayeva was unfortunately caught up in that Russian doping scandal -- but her country is once again having to answer for positive tests. The latest coming from the 2008 Games, where Anastasia Kapachinskaya's sample was retested and came back positive. The sprinter was part of the country's 4x400-metre relay team that won silver, so she has to give that medal back.
Retest shows Anastasia Kapachinskaya took banned substance
Kapachinskaya and her teammates finished second, behind the US. With them being stripped of the medal that means, Jamaica and Belarus move up to the silver and bronze positions. The athlete also competed in the 400-metres in 2008, where she placed fifth, that result has also be removed from the official records. Russia have already been stripped of the 4x100m women's relay gold from Beijing.
